สารบัญ:
- เสบียง
- ขั้นตอนที่ 1: แบบจำลองทางกายภาพของรถถัง
- ขั้นตอนที่ 2: การเชื่อมต่อทางไฟฟ้า
- ขั้นตอนที่ 3: Arduino Sketch
- ขั้นตอนที่ 4: การผลิต
- ขั้นตอนที่ 5: รถถังในการใช้งาน
วีดีโอ: Halo Scorpion Tank: 5 ขั้นตอน
2024 ผู้เขียน: John Day | [email protected]. แก้ไขล่าสุด: 2024-01-30 13:04
คำแนะนำนี้สร้างขึ้นเพื่อตอบสนองความต้องการของโครงการ Makecourse ที่มหาวิทยาลัยเซาท์ฟลอริดา (www.makecourse.com) นี่คือกระบวนการทีละขั้นตอนของฉันในการออกแบบและสร้าง Halo Scorpion Tank ที่ทำงานได้อย่างสมบูรณ์
ลิงก์ด้านล่างเป็นลิงก์สาธารณะของ Google ไดรฟ์ที่ฉันสร้างซึ่งมีโค้ด Arduino และไฟล์ Cad
drive.google.com/drive/folders/1GwZ-I4mqI2Tr2PBN8NXjsTcEG1HR1abR?usp=sharing
เสบียง
ซึ่งจะเกี่ยวข้องกับชิ้นส่วนที่พิมพ์ 3 มิติ ปืนกาวร้อน และฮาร์ดแวร์บางส่วนเพื่อประกอบโปรเจ็กต์เข้าด้วยกัน
ขั้นตอนที่ 1: แบบจำลองทางกายภาพของรถถัง
การออกแบบเป็นแบบจำลองบน Solidworks 2019 โดยมีแชสซีเต็มรูปแบบ การออกแบบหลักประกอบด้วยโครงที่แบ่งครึ่งเพื่อพิมพ์บนเครื่องพิมพ์ Ender 3 ชิ้นส่วนที่เหลือรวมถึงการชุบเกราะท้ายเรือและการชุบกราบขวาบน แผ่นขั้วต่อสองแผ่นที่ใช้ยึดทั้งสองส่วนของโครงเครื่องเข้าด้วยกัน ป้อมปืนและปืนใหญ่ถูกพิมพ์แยกกันเป็นสองชิ้น ชิ้นสุดท้ายที่พิมพ์คือเพลาล้อหน้าสองล้อ โปรดทราบว่าล้อจำลองใน CAD เป็นเพียงการแสดงเท่านั้น ล้อจริงเป็นอะไหล่ที่ซื้อมา
ขั้นตอนที่ 2: การเชื่อมต่อทางไฟฟ้า
ระบบควบคุมที่ฉันตัดสินใจใช้นั้นใช้มอเตอร์กระแสตรงสองตัวและเซอร์โวมอเตอร์หนึ่งตัว เซอร์โวมอเตอร์ควบคุมป้อมปืนด้วยตำแหน่งที่กำหนดไว้สามตำแหน่งที่ 0 องศา 90 องศาและ 180 องศา มอเตอร์ DC สองตัวประกอบกันเป็นชุดขับเคลื่อนของทั้งระบบและอยู่ในตำแหน่งด้านหลังสำหรับถังขับเคลื่อนล้อหลัง รูปแบบการควบคุมใช้ Arduino UNO และชิ้นส่วนจากร้าน UCTRONICS ชิ้นส่วนที่ได้รับจากร้าน UCTRONICS ได้แก่ ตัวควบคุมมอเตอร์ (รูปที่สอง), ชุดแบตเตอรี่, เซอร์โวและมอเตอร์กระแสตรงสองตัว ภาพสุดท้ายประกอบด้วยชุดสายไฟแบบสมบูรณ์ที่ต่อเข้าด้วยกันภายในแชสซี ในภาพแผนภาพบล็อกด้านบน คุณจะเห็นว่าระบบควบคุมผ่านอินฟราเรด (IR) แผนการควบคุมนี้ทำงานได้อย่างสมบูรณ์แบบกับตัวควบคุมมอเตอร์ UCTRONICS เนื่องจากตัวควบคุมมอเตอร์มีเซ็นเซอร์ IR ในตัว จึงช่วยลดการใช้อุปกรณ์อิเล็กทรอนิกส์ทางกายภาพ บรรจุุภัณฑ์. ภาพสุดท้ายคือรีโมตคอนโทรล IR ซึ่งสามารถสลับและตั้งโปรแกรมด้วยรีโมตคอนโทรล IR ที่คุณต้องการ สิ่งนี้อธิบายได้ดีที่สุดในขั้นตอนร่างโค้ด Arduino
ขั้นตอนที่ 3: Arduino Sketch
ร่าง Arduino สำหรับการประกอบทั้งหมดนั้นง่ายมาก ใช้ไลบรารีตัวควบคุมมอเตอร์ adafruit เพื่อควบคุมมอเตอร์ DC ไลบรารีเซอร์โวมอเตอร์มาตรฐานเพื่อควบคุมป้อมปืน และไลบรารีเซ็นเซอร์อินฟราเรดเพื่อควบคุมถังทั้งหมด โครงสร้างของโค้ดช่วยให้คุณใช้รีโมตคอนโทรล IR และค้นหาค่าที่เกี่ยวข้องบนรีโมตเพื่อตั้งโปรแกรม Arduino ให้ทำงานกับรีโมต IR
ขั้นตอนที่ 4: การผลิต
การประดิษฐ์และการประกอบชิ้นส่วนทำได้ง่ายมาก โดยทั้งสองครึ่งของแชสซีถูกยึดเข้าด้วยกันโดยใช้สกรู 6-24 ตัว สกรูยาว 6-24 ตัวที่ยอมรับได้ แชสซีถูกพิมพ์ 3 มิติโดยมีรูที่สร้างแบบจำลองไว้ในไฟล์ CAD แล้ว มอเตอร์ยังมาพร้อมกับสกรูเครื่อง M3 ที่สลักเข้ากับเฟรมของชุดประกอบ ฉันใช้สกรูเพียงตัวเดียวต่อมอเตอร์เพื่อให้ระยะห่างจากล้อเพียงพอเมื่อยึดเข้ากับมอเตอร์ ล้อขนาด 65 มม. เลื่อนเข้าไปในเพลาของมอเตอร์ (ดูรูปที่ 3) และหัวสกรูจะยื่นออกมาเล็กน้อย ดังนั้นจึงต้องใช้สกรูเพียงตัวเดียวในการประกอบโครงสร้างมอเตอร์แชสซี จากนั้นยึดมอเตอร์ให้เข้าที่ด้วยกาวร้อนเพื่อให้มีโครงสร้างและความปลอดภัยที่ดีขึ้นแก่มอเตอร์ ล้อหน้าถูกยึดเข้าด้วยกันผ่านเพลาพิมพ์ 3 มิติ และใช้แหวนรองทองเหลือง SAE 3 #10 เป็นแผ่นรองเพื่อเว้นระยะล้อหน้าอย่างเหมาะสม ล้อจะยึดเข้าด้วยกันโดยใช้กาวร้อน สิ่งนี้ทำให้แอสเซมบลีถาวร แต่ทำให้แอสเซมบลีค่อนข้างแข็งแรง อุปกรณ์อิเล็กทรอนิกส์ภายในถูกยึดเข้าด้วยกันโดยใช้เทปกาวสองหน้าที่ยึดแบตเตอรี่และตัวควบคุมมอเตอร์และ Arduino ขั้นตอนต่อไปคือการใช้กาวร้อนเพื่อยึดเซอร์โวที่ด้านหลังสำหรับการประกอบป้อมปืน ภาพที่สองถึงสุดท้ายแสดงให้เห็นว่าแผ่นด้านหน้ามีรูเจาะเข้าไปอย่างไร นี่คือขั้นตอนหลังการชุบเกราะหน้าบนของรถถัง เจาะรูสี่รูโดยใช้ดอกสว่านขนาด 3/8 ทั้งสองอันข้างหน้าใช้สำหรับสายแบตเตอรี่ที่เดินจากด้านหลังของถังไปยังด้านหน้าซึ่งมีช่องเสียบตัวควบคุมมอเตอร์ รูด้านหน้าที่สองเจาะออกมาเพื่อสร้าง ระยะการมองเห็นที่ชัดเจนสำหรับเซ็นเซอร์ IR เพื่อสัมผัสกับรีโมท IR ป้อมปืนถูกพิมพ์ 3 มิติและติดกาวร้อนเข้าด้วยกันแล้วติดกาวที่ด้านบนของป้อมปืน ขั้นตอนสุดท้ายคือการยึดเพลทด้านบนเข้าด้วยกันเข้ากับแชสซี. จากนั้นกันชนหน้าจะติดกาวร้อนที่ด้านหน้าและด้านหลังของแชสซี มีหลายวิธีสำหรับสิ่งนี้ แต่ฉันชอบใช้เทปเป็ดสีพิเศษเพื่อยึดส่วนประกอบทั้งหมดเข้าด้วยกัน มันช่วยยึดสายไฟหลวม ๆ และทำหน้าที่เป็นวิธี เพื่อเพิ่มลวดลายลงบนตัวถัง
ขั้นตอนที่ 5: รถถังในการใช้งาน
วิดีโอเหล่านี้แสดงให้เห็นว่าคุณกำลังทำอะไรอยู่ ในโครงการของคุณ สิ่งนี้แสดงการสาธิตการหมุนเดือยไปข้างหน้าและการเปลี่ยนตำแหน่งป้อมปืน
แนะนำ:
WiFi Oil Tank Monitor: 6 ขั้นตอน (พร้อมรูปภาพ)
WiFi Oil Tank Monitor: มีหลายวิธีในการตรวจสอบว่ายังมีน้ำมันเหลืออยู่ในถังน้ำมันสำหรับทำความร้อน วิธีที่ง่ายที่สุดคือการใช้ก้านวัดระดับน้ำมัน แม่นยำมาก แต่ไม่สนุกมากนักในวันที่อากาศหนาวเย็น รถถังบางคันมีการติดตั้งท่อสายตา อีกครั้งเพื่อบ่งชี้โดยตรง o
วิธีสร้างหุ่นยนต์ SMARS - Arduino Smart Robot Tank Bluetooth: 16 ขั้นตอน (พร้อมรูปภาพ)
วิธีสร้างหุ่นยนต์ SMARS - Arduino Smart Robot Tank Bluetooth: บทความนี้ได้รับการสนับสนุนอย่างภาคภูมิใจโดย PCBWAY.PCBWAY สร้าง PCB ต้นแบบคุณภาพสูงสำหรับผู้คนทั่วโลก ลองด้วยตัวคุณเองและรับ 10 PCBs เพียง $5 ที่ PCBWAY ด้วยคุณภาพที่ยอดเยี่ยมมาก ขอบคุณ PCBWAY Motor Shield สำหรับ Arduino Uno
HALO: หลอดไฟ Arduino ที่มีประโยชน์ Rev1.0 W/NeoPixels: 9 ขั้นตอน (พร้อมรูปภาพ)
HALO: Handy Arduino Lamp Rev1.0 W/NeoPixels: ในคำแนะนำนี้ ฉันจะแสดงวิธีสร้าง HALO หรือ Handy Arduino Lamp Rev1.0 HALO เป็นหลอดไฟธรรมดาที่ขับเคลื่อนโดย Arduino Nano มีรอยเท้าทั้งหมดประมาณ 2" โดย 3" และฐานไม้ถ่วงน้ำหนักเพื่อความมั่นคงสูงสุด ชั้น
ฮาร์ดไดรฟ์พกพา Halo 2: 5 ขั้นตอน
ฮาร์ดไดรฟ์แบบพกพา Halo 2: มีไอพอดที่เสีย มีเคส XBOX 360 Halo 2 ตอนนี้ปล่อยให้พวกเขาผสมผสาน ค่าใช้จ่ายทั้งหมด. $3.50 + 4 SHMaterials-Dead Ipod (30 GB) (ฟรี) อยู่ริมถนน Sweet XD-Empty XBOX 360 Case (ฟรี) (พบในกล่องหลัง BlockBuster) -2.5" เป็น USB Converter (
ชุดติดตั้งเพิ่มหลอดไฟ LED สำหรับ Halo 998 Eyeball Trim: 8 ขั้นตอน
ชุดติดตั้งเพิ่มหลอดไฟ LED สำหรับ Halo 998 Eyeball Trim: คำแนะนำนี้จะอธิบายวิธีการปรับเปลี่ยนชิ้นส่วนตัดแต่งลูกตา Halo 998 ให้ยอมรับหลอดไฟหรี่แสงได้ LumiSelect PAR/R16 จาก earthled.com หลอดไฟ LED มีขนาดใหญ่เกินไปที่จะพอดีกับการเปิดตาของลูกตา ชิ้นแต่มีเอฟเฟ